What Happened on January 28, 1949

Historical Events

  • NY Giants sign their 1st black players, Monte Irvin & Ford Smith
  • UN Security council convicts Dutch aggression in Indonesia

Famous Birthdays

  • Eddie Bayers, American session drummer, based in Nashville, born in Patuxent, Maryland
  • Gene McFadden, American singer, songwriter, and record producer (Philadelphia International Records; McFadden & Whitehead - "Ain't No Stoppin' Us Now"), born in Olanta, South Carolina (d. 2006) [1]
  • Gregg Popovich, American Basketball HOF coach and executive (NBA C'ship 1999, 2003, 05, 07, 14; NBA Coach of the Year 2003, 12, 14; San Antonio Spurs; Olympic gold 2020), born in East Chicago, Indiana
  • Jerzy Szczakiel, Polish speedway rider (World Individual C'ship 1973; World Pairs C'ship 1971), born in Grudzicach, Poland (d. 2020)
  • Thomas J. Downey, American politician (Rep-D-NY, 1975-93), born in Queens, New York

Famous Deaths

  • Gustaf Lazarus Nordqvist, Swedish organist and composer, dies at 62
  • Jean-Pierre Wimille, French auto racer (24 Hours of Le Mans 1937, 39 Bugatti T57), dies in practice accident for Buenos Aires GP at 40
